AUTHOR: Dr.Robert H. Miller has written nine children's books for Simon & Schuster and Macmillan on the role of African Americans in settling the 'Old West'. The first four book series, “Reflections of a Black Cowboy” is written for fourth through eighth grade level; Book 1, Cowboys, Book 2, Buffalo Soldiers, Book 3, Pioneers and Book 4, Mountain Men. The second four book series for kindergarten through second grade is a picture book series entitled, “Stories from the Forgotten West”. The chapter book “A Pony for Jeremiah”, written for fourth grade reading and above rounds out the trilogy series about African Americans in the settling of the western frontier. He is a public speaker and has written for film and television. His new children’s book just released by Kindle Publishing is, “Once Upon a Time in the Black West”. Dr. Miller holds a Ph.D. in African American Studies from Temple University and has created a variety of courses dealing with the African American experience in the United States.
